Boxing club gears up for home show

Spennymoor’s boxers are looking to their home show on Saturday 11 October.

Spennymoor Boxing Academy is proud to announce its home show on Saturday 11 October, when they will welcome Ardoyne Holy Cross Boxing Club from Belfast to the North East.

Earlier this year, the Academy travelled across to Belfast to take part in their home show.

The event was packed with competitive bouts, and although Spennymoor came out on top overall, it was much more than just results.

The hospitality shown by Ardoyne Holy Cross was outstanding, and the trip proved to be a fantastic team bonding experience for the boxers and coaches. Friendships were formed, respect was earned, and the spirit of amateur boxing shone through.

Now it’s Spennymoor’s turn to return that generosity, and they are determined to give their visitors from Belfast the same warm welcome here in Spennymoor.

With an exciting card of local and visiting talent, they are confident it will be a night to remember for both boxers and spectators.

“As ever, nights like this would not be possible without the help of those who continue to support us,” said Rob Ellis, Head Coach of Spennymoor Boxing Academy.

“I would like to personally thank Spennymoor town councillors and our dedicated sponsors for standing by the Academy.

“Their backing ensures we can keep providing affordable opportunities for young people in the community to learn, grow, and succeed through the sport of boxing.
